Anyone who goes to WVU, can you tell me what the dress code is?

Well below i pasted the academic standards dress code, but most of the time everyone wheres scrubs...the scrubs can be bought at the bookstore..they are navy blue or light blue with the wvu school of dentistry on the shirt. Some ppl like to dress up...but its up to you dress clothes or scrubs

STANDARD ATTIRE
A. DRESS CLOTHES (Women)
1. Slacks, crop pants, or capris
2. Dresses, skirts, skorts, or dress shorts not higher than 3 inches above the knee
3. Blouses/golf shirts
4. Dress tops
5. Dress shoes

B. DRESS CLOTHES (Men)
1. Slacks (dress, khaki)
2. Shirt with collar
3. Dress tops
4. Dress shoes

C. SCRUBS
1. Scrub tops and pants of appropriate color (navy or light blue)
2. Pants must be permanently hemmed so they do not drag on the floor.
3. Coordinating scrub jackets or a white coat may be worn.

4. Shoes must be clean with closed toes accompanied by clean socks or hosiery.
5. A clean plain t-shirt with long or short sleeves and a low collar (no turtlenecks) may be worn tucked in under scrubs.
6. Scrubs must be clean and free of wrinkles.
7. Dental students must wear navy blue scrubs or light blueembroidered with the WVU School of Dentistry logo. This policy became effective with the Dental School Class of 2008. Dental hygiene students may wear only white or shades of blue, green, purple, pink, purple, or burgundy.
F. MISCELLANEOUS INFORMATION
1. Standard attire must be worn between 8:00 am and 5:00 pm by all faculty, staff, or students.
 
josh is this jsut for clinic? can you wear whatever you want to classes? then scrubs to clinic?
 
no this is the dress code for any time you are in the dental school monday - friday 8-5 class or clinic...most ppl wear scrubs because even when your not in clinic you could be in the lab and sometimes it gets messy...
 
Josh hit this one on the nose. Scrubs or nice clothes (professional attire). Scrubs are just easier since you're suppose to wear a lab coat during lab if you're wearing anything else.
